Chloé’s Summer 2026 campaign celebrates light, movement, and feminine complicity. Photographed by Sam Rock and directed on film by Romain Wygas, it features six women inhabiting a coastal utopia where garments, sun, and natural landscapes merge. The collection embodies freedom, intuition, and playful sophistication.

Mugler’s Stardust Aphrodite Spring–Summer 2026 campaign marks the first visual narrative under Creative Director Miguel Castro Freitas. Shot by Robi Rodriguez, the campaign channels neon-soaked B-movie surrealism, sculptural tailoring, and cinematic storytelling to introduce a bold, retro-futuristic vision of modern femininity.

Luxury is rarely static, and in Louis Vuitton’s Spring–Summer 2026 menswear campaign, motion becomes meaning. Under the creative direction of Pharrell Williams, the House revisits its historic connection to travel, not as nostalgia, but as evolution. This season, movement is not simply about geography; it is about identity in flux, about the refinement that comes from crossing cultures and inhabiting the space between departure and arrival. SS26 does not merely present clothes, it presents a philosophy of modern elegance shaped by transit, transformation, and global perspective.
